How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ration Actually Works

When you call us for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ration, our team springs into action. We understand the importance of a proper process, and we won’t cut any corners. Our technicians will arrive within 60 minutes, equipped with state-of-the-art equipment to extract water, dry out areas, and repair damaged drywall.

Initial Assessment

Our technician will conduct a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. They’ll use thermal imaging cameras to detect any hidden water damage.

Water Extraction

Our technician will use a water extraction truck to remove any standing water from your property. We’ll use a wet/dry vacuum to remove excess water from the affected area.

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ial dehumidifiers and fans to dry out the affected area. This process can take 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Drywall Repair

Once the area is dry, our technician will repair any damaged drywall. We’ll use a combination of patching and painting to match the existing finish.

Final Inspection

Our technician will conduct a final inspection to ensure the damage is fully repaired and the area is safe and dry.

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Don’t ignore the warning signs, or you might face more extensive and costly repairs.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ak or a burst pipe. Don’t wait till the water damage spreads to your floors.

Musty Odors in Your Home

Musty odors in your home can show a hidden water damage issue. Our team can help you detect and repair the problem before it’s too late.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or moisture buildup. Don’t ignore the signs, or you might face costly repairs.

Sagging Ceilings or Floors

Sagging ceilings or floors can show a structural issue or water damage. Our team can help you assess and repair the damage before it’s too late.

Buckling Drywall or Baseboards

Buckling drywall or baseboards can be a sign of water damage or moisture buildup. Don’t ignore the signs, or you might face costly repairs.

Unexplained Mold or Mildew Growth

Unexplained mold or mildew growth can show a hidden water damage issue. Our team can help you detect and repair the problem before it’s too late.

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ration Cost In Neosho, MO

The cost of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Neosho, MO.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500-$2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Drywall Repair $300-$1,500 Size of affected area, type of repair needed
Final Inspection and Certificate of Completion $100-$500 Size of affected area, complexity of repair
More Labor or Materials $500-$2,500 Size of affected area, type of repair needed

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services.

How long will it take to repair my ceiling drywall?

The repair time dep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In most cases, we can complete the repair within 3-5 days.

Will I need to replace my entire ceiling?

Not always. Depending on the extent of the damage, we may be able to repair or replace individual sections of drywall. Our technician will assess the damage and recommend the best course of action.

Can I paint over water-damaged drywall?

No, it’s not recommended to paint over water-damaged drywall. Water damage can weaken the drywall, causing it to crumble or collapse when painted over. Our team will assess and repair the damage before painting.
